How correlated are SPY and USAU?

Across a 3-year window, the weekly returns of SPY and USAU correlate at 0.36, moderate. The link has tightened recently: the 1-year correlation (0.47) runs above the 3-year figure (0.36). Stretching to 5 years gives 0.35, with an annualized covariance of 361.5 %².

Within SPY's tracked universe of 4755 assets, USAU comes in at #1596 by 3-year correlation. Neither side won the trailing year by much: +20.6% against +23.6%. Note the risk asymmetry: USAU runs 4.8 times the annualized volatility of the other leg, so equal-weighting the two is not an equal-risk position.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of 0.36 mean?

Correlation ranges from −1 to +1. Values near +1 mean two assets move together, near 0 that they move independently, and negative values that they tend to move in opposite directions. It measures co-movement, not performance.
